Cole Baughman is 8 years old and a 2nd grader at Batavia Elementary. Cole was born in July 2009 fighting for his life. He spent 9 days in the NICU and made his first trip to Cincinnati Children's Hospital at 7 days old. At the age of 3 years old he was diagnosed with Stickers Syndrome, a genetic disorder that can cause serious vision, hearing and joint problems. He has undergone numerous procedures and over 6 surgeries, including 2 cleft palate repairs.
